Tofu Masala Scramble (High-Protein, Vegan & Flavor-Packed)

Servings: 2 Total Time: 20 mins Difficulty: Beginner
A high-protein, oil-free vegan scramble with Indian spices

This tofu masala scramble is a savory, protein-rich vegan breakfast that’s bold, flavorful, and oil-free. Made with tofu, garlic, onion, tomato, peas, and classic Indian spices like turmeric, coriander powder, chili garlic powder, and salt, it’s a perfect plant-based start to your day.

Soft, seasoned tofu pairs beautifully with fresh vegetables and warming spices, creating a comforting scramble that’s high in protein, fiber, and essential nutrients while remaining light and easy to digest. Every bite delivers a satisfying balance of spice and freshness, making it ideal for quick breakfasts, meal prep, or a healthy brunch.

Unlike traditional scrambles that rely on eggs or heavy oils, this recipe is vegan, oil-free, and refined sugar-free, supporting steady energy and a clean start to your morning. Instructions

  1. Chop and prepare all the vegetables before you start cooking.

    Heat a pan over medium heat and add the chopped onions. Sauté until translucent.

  1. Add the chopped garlic and cook until the mix turns fragrant. If it starts sticking to the pan, add a little water.

  1. Add Jalapeno peppers and let it cook for a minute.

    Add a little water to prevent sticking and aid the cooking process.

  1. Add the chopped tomatoes and cook until they completely break down and form a thick, saucy base.

  1. Add the boiled peas and stir to combine.

    Add water, if required.

  1. Break the tofu into bite-sized pieces and add it to the pan. Cook until most of the moisture evaporates.

  1. In a small bowl, make the chickpea flour slurry by mixing 1 tablespoon chickpea flour with 4 tablespoons water until smooth.

    Add the slurry to the pan and cook, stirring continuously, until the mixture thickens and the raw chickpea flour smell disappears.

  1. Remove from heat and sprinkle with fresh cilantro.

    Serve hot with sliced avocado.
